    Why Protein Treatments Are Your Hair's Best Friend

    Alright, let's talk about why protein treatments are so darn important. Think of your hair like a building. The main structural component, the bricks, are made of protein – specifically, keratin. Over time, things like heat styling, chemical treatments (perms, relaxers, coloring), and even just everyday wear and tear can damage those protein structures, leaving your hair weak, brittle, and prone to breakage. This is where protein treatments swoop in to save the day! Protein treatments work by replenishing the protein that your hair has lost, effectively repairing and strengthening the hair shaft. They fill in the gaps, making your hair smoother, more resilient, and less likely to snap off when you brush it. Imagine your hair feeling like silk after a treatment. Sounds good, right?

    For those of us who regularly use heat tools, like a hairdryer, curling iron, or straightener, protein treatments are practically a necessity. Heat breaks down the protein in your hair, and the damage can be cumulative. Chemical treatments also take a toll. Bleaching, in particular, is notorious for stripping away protein and leaving your hair feeling like straw. If you've noticed increased shedding, split ends, or a general lack of elasticity, it might be time to consider a protein treatment. The frequency of treatments will depend on your hair type and the level of damage, but generally, a treatment every few weeks or once a month is a good starting point. Just remember, it's all about finding what works best for your hair. We are all unique, so what works for your bestie might not work for you!

    Protein treatments aren't just for damaged hair, though. Even if your hair is relatively healthy, a protein treatment can help to improve its overall strength, shine, and manageability. They can also be a great way to prepare your hair for other treatments, like coloring or perming. By strengthening the hair beforehand, you're essentially creating a more resilient base, which can help to minimize damage during the chemical process. So, whether you're trying to repair existing damage or simply want to boost your hair's health, protein treatments are a valuable tool in your hair care arsenal.     Understanding the Different Types of Protein Treatments

    Okay, so we've established why protein treatments are great, but let's chat about the different types out there. This is where things can get a little confusing, but don't worry, I'll break it down for you in a way that's super easy to understand. There are two main categories of protein treatments: light protein treatments and deep protein treatments. Knowing the difference is key to choosing the right product for your hair.

    Light protein treatments are like a quick pick-me-up for your hair. They contain smaller protein molecules that can easily penetrate the hair shaft and provide a temporary boost of strength and shine. These are usually found in everyday conditioners and leave-in products. Think of these as your daily dose of protein, perfect for maintaining healthy hair and preventing minor damage. They're great for all hair types, but especially beneficial for those who have fine or low-porosity hair, as they won't weigh your hair down.

    Deep protein treatments, on the other hand, are the heavy hitters. These treatments contain larger protein molecules that deeply penetrate the hair shaft to repair more significant damage. They often include additional ingredients like amino acids, hydrolyzed proteins, and other strengthening agents. Deep protein treatments are typically used on hair that has been significantly damaged by chemical treatments or heat styling. They can be a bit more intense, so it's important to use them with caution and not overdo it. Overuse can lead to protein overload, which can make your hair feel stiff and brittle.

    Within these categories, you'll also find treatments that use different types of protein, such as hydrolyzed keratin, soy protein, wheat protein, and silk amino acids. Each type of protein has its own unique benefits, but they all work to strengthen and repair the hair. Hydrolyzed keratin is a popular choice for its ability to penetrate the hair shaft and bond with the hair's natural keratin. Soy protein and wheat protein are often used for their moisturizing properties, while silk amino acids add shine and smoothness. So, when choosing a product, don't be afraid to read the ingredient list and look for the specific types of protein that best suit your hair's needs.     How to Use Protein Treatment Products Correctly

    Alright, let's talk about the right way to use protein treatment products. It's not just about slapping on a product and hoping for the best! Following these steps will help you get the most out of your protein treatments and avoid any potential issues:

    1. Start with Clean Hair: Before applying a protein treatment, always start with clean hair. Shampoo your hair to remove any buildup of product, oil, or dirt. This will allow the protein treatment to penetrate the hair shaft more effectively. Use a clarifying shampoo to remove any heavy build-up from your hair!

    2. Follow the Instructions: Each product is different, so it's important to read and follow the instructions on the label. Some treatments require you to apply the product to damp hair, while others work best on dry hair. Some require heat, while others do not. Don't skip this step!

    3. Don't Overdo It: Overusing protein treatments can lead to protein overload, which can make your hair feel stiff, brittle, and even break off. Start with a treatment once every few weeks or once a month, and adjust the frequency based on your hair's needs. Watch out for signs of protein overload, such as excessive dryness or stiffness. If you notice these signs, cut back on the treatments and focus on moisturizing your hair. You can never go wrong with a good hair mask!

    4. Balance with Moisture: Protein treatments are designed to strengthen the hair, but they can sometimes be drying. Always follow up a protein treatment with a moisturizing conditioner or deep conditioner to restore hydration and keep your hair balanced. This will help to prevent breakage and keep your hair feeling soft and manageable. This is a crucial step!

    5. Listen to Your Hair: The most important thing is to listen to your hair. Pay attention to how your hair feels after each treatment. If it feels stronger and healthier, you're on the right track. If it feels stiff or brittle, you may need to adjust the frequency or type of treatment you're using.
